Healthcare Assistant - Laois, Ireland - Emeis
Description
As part of working with emeis Ireland you get to work with the largest nursing home group in EuropeBenefits of working:
Competitive Hourly Rates Refer a Friend scheme up to €500-€3000 bonus Meals provided on duty Employee Assistance Programme Full Time Contracts Career progression opportunities within Ireland and Europe Uniform provided emeis Ireland are looking for kind and caring Healthcare Assistants to join our team to enhance and support an excellent quality of daily life for our residents
We are recruiting in:
The Residence, Portlaoise, our brand new state of the art purpose-built Nursing Home set in large grounds within a short distance of Portlaoise town centre
Responsibilities & Requirements:
Making a positive difference and enhancing our clients daily lives. Experience working as a Healthcare Assistant including dementia care. Supporting with all duties including personal care requirements. Supporting social interactions & activities. Be kind, caring, empathetic and trustworthy with a genuine interest to help others. Minimum Level 5 QQI Healthcare qualification in Healthcare Support or higher.
Excellent interpersonal and communication skills in the English language written and verbal Must be able to provide 2 valid and contactable references Good knowledge of HIQA requirements.
